Improving C# Memory Safety
Microsoft has announced improvements to C# memory safety, aiming to reduce the risk of memory-related bugs and vulnerabilities. C# is a widely-used programming language developed by Microsoft, and memory safety is a critical aspect of software development. The improvements are expected to enhance the overall security and reliability of C# applications. This move is part of Microsoft's ongoing efforts to strengthen the security and stability of its programming languages.
This development is significant for developers and businesses that rely on C# for building software applications, as it will help reduce the risk of memory-related issues and improve overall system security.
